How do I make a tabbed page show via Javascript or HTML when link clicked?

I have a page with dynamically created links via PHP. One of these links loads a named page (if not already loaded, via HTML or Javascript). If the page is already in a tab then clicking the link causes the page to reload but the page does not show unless I click on the tab. How can I force the tabbed page to show (already loaded) when the link is clicked? I've tried using the Javascript window.focus() method but it does not solve the problem. This issue does not happen with the Safari browser.
